Skip site navigation (1)Skip section navigation (2)
Date:      Sun, 8 Mar 2009 10:58:37 +0000 (UTC)
From:      Robert Watson <rwatson@FreeBSD.org>
To:        cvs-src-old@freebsd.org
Subject:   cvs commit: src/sys/kern kern_prot.c src/sys/security/audit audit_syscalls.c src/sys/security/mac mac_audit.c mac_cred.c mac_framework.c mac_framework.h mac_policy.h mac_process.c src/sys/security/mac_stub mac_stub.c src/sys/security/mac_test ...
Message-ID:  <200903081059.n28AxUjr027435@repoman.freebsd.org>

next in thread | raw e-mail | index | archive | help
rwatson     2009-03-08 10:58:37 UTC

  FreeBSD src repository

  Modified files:
    sys/kern             kern_prot.c 
    sys/security/audit   audit_syscalls.c 
    sys/security/mac     mac_audit.c mac_cred.c mac_framework.c 
                         mac_framework.h mac_policy.h 
                         mac_process.c 
    sys/security/mac_stub mac_stub.c 
    sys/security/mac_test mac_test.c 
  Log:
  SVN rev 189529 on 2009-03-08 10:58:37Z by rwatson
  
  Improve the consistency of MAC Framework and MAC policy entry point
  naming by renaming certain "proc" entry points to "cred" entry points,
  reflecting their manipulation of credentials.  For some entry points,
  the process was passed into the framework but not into policies; in
  these cases, stop passing in the process since we don't need it.
  
    mac_proc_check_setaudit -> mac_cred_check_setaudit
    mac_proc_check_setaudit_addr -> mac_cred_check_setaudit_addr
    mac_proc_check_setauid -> mac_cred_check_setauid
    mac_proc_check_setegid -> mac_cred_check_setegid
    mac_proc_check_seteuid -> mac_cred_check_seteuid
    mac_proc_check_setgid -> mac_cred_check_setgid
    mac_proc_check_setgroups -> mac_cred_ceck_setgroups
    mac_proc_check_setregid -> mac_cred_check_setregid
    mac_proc_check_setresgid -> mac_cred_check_setresgid
    mac_proc_check_setresuid -> mac_cred_check_setresuid
    mac_proc_check_setreuid -> mac_cred_check_setreuid
    mac_proc_check_setuid -> mac_cred_check_setuid
  
  Obtained from:  TrustedBSD Project
  Sponsored by:   Google, Inc.
  
  Revision  Changes    Path
  1.216     +9 -9      src/sys/kern/kern_prot.c
  1.36      +3 -3      src/sys/security/audit/audit_syscalls.c
  1.6       +12 -12    src/sys/security/mac/mac_audit.c
  1.3       +126 -0    src/sys/security/mac/mac_cred.c
  1.142     +3 -0      src/sys/security/mac/mac_framework.c
  1.107     +20 -23    src/sys/security/mac/mac_framework.h
  1.117     +35 -32    src/sys/security/mac/mac_policy.h
  1.130     +0 -148    src/sys/security/mac/mac_process.c
  1.93      +103 -100  src/sys/security/mac_stub/mac_stub.c
  1.106     +152 -149  src/sys/security/mac_test/mac_test.c



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?200903081059.n28AxUjr027435>